Text XML Editor Intype

Intype is a text, code and xml editor for the Windows operating system that resembles advanced editors like Notepad++ in many aspects. It features the same extensibility and customizability as the popular Notepad replacement including scripting support and native plugin support. Copy text without formatting

I sometimes quote websites and do a normal copy paste job to copy the website content to the editor of my blog or into a word processor. Unfortunately this copy job always pastes the original formatting of the original source to the editor as well which means that the text may have a different size, font type or color. It is quite a hassle to remove the formatting of the copied contents to make it look like the rest of your content.
